VPN与系统更新冲突问题解析及解决方案

vpn下载 2026-05-16 05:40:56 7 0

在现代企业网络和家庭用户环境中,虚拟私人网络(VPN)已成为保障数据安全、实现远程访问的核心工具,在日常使用中,许多用户常常遇到一个令人困扰的问题:当系统进行自动更新时,原本稳定的VPN连接突然中断,甚至无法重新建立连接,这种“VPN与系统更新冲突”的现象不仅影响工作效率,还可能带来潜在的安全风险,作为一名网络工程师,我将从技术原理、常见原因和实用解决方案三个方面,深入剖析这一问题,并提供可操作的建议。

我们需要理解为何系统更新会干扰VPN连接,大多数操作系统(如Windows、macOS、Linux)在执行更新时,会重启网络服务、修改防火墙规则、替换内核模块或更新驱动程序,Windows在安装更新后通常会重启系统并重新加载网络适配器驱动,这可能导致旧版的VPN客户端无法识别新版本的驱动或协议栈,部分更新可能涉及SSL/TLS证书库的变更,导致基于证书认证的VPN(如OpenVPN或IPsec)因证书不匹配而失败。

常见的冲突场景包括:

  1. 驱动兼容性问题:更新后的网络驱动与原有VPN软件不兼容,尤其是一些第三方VPN客户端(如Cisco AnyConnect、FortiClient)依赖特定驱动。
  2. 防火墙策略更改:系统更新后默认防火墙规则可能关闭了VPN使用的端口(如UDP 500、4500用于IPsec),或阻止了相关进程。
  3. DNS设置重置:某些更新会重置网络配置,使DNS服务器被设为默认值,从而导致域名解析失败,无法连接到远程VPN网关。
  4. 证书信任链失效:若更新过程中删除或更新了受信任的CA证书,基于证书认证的VPN连接将报错“证书无效”。

针对上述问题,网络工程师推荐以下解决方案:

提前规划与测试

  • 在部署大规模系统更新前,先在测试环境中验证现有VPN配置是否兼容新版系统,使用Windows Server Update Services (WSUS) 或 Intune 分阶段推送更新。
  • 确保所有设备上的VPN客户端为最新版本,避免因老旧版本导致兼容性问题。

调整系统更新策略

  • 对于关键业务系统,可配置Windows更新为“通知安装”而非“自动安装”,以便在维护窗口期间手动触发更新。
  • 使用组策略(GPO)或移动设备管理(MDM)工具,限制某些更新项(如网络驱动更新)自动应用。

优化网络与安全配置

  • 检查防火墙规则,确保允许必要的VPN端口通行,可在Windows Defender防火墙中创建入站/出站规则,指定允许的VPN应用程序(如openvpn.exe)。
  • 手动设置静态DNS服务器(如8.8.8.8),防止更新后DNS被劫持或重置。
  • 定期备份当前的VPN配置文件和证书,便于快速恢复。

监控与日志分析

  • 启用系统事件查看器(Event Viewer)中的“System”和“Application”日志,筛选与网络、VPN相关的错误信息(如事件ID 10000、4201等)。
  • 使用Wireshark或tcpdump抓包分析连接失败的具体环节,判断是认证失败、握手超时还是路由问题。

建议企业用户采用零信任架构(Zero Trust)替代传统VPN方案,如使用Cloudflare Access、Zscaler或Microsoft Azure AD Conditional Access,这些方案无需本地客户端,通过浏览器即可安全访问资源,从根本上规避了“系统更新破坏连接”的痛点。

VPN与系统更新的冲突并非不可解决,关键在于预防为主、配置严谨、及时响应,作为网络工程师,我们不仅要修复问题,更要构建健壮、可扩展的网络环境,让安全与稳定并存。

VPN与系统更新冲突问题解析及解决方案

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!